I got my Dr. Gas out of the corral classifieds for 180 brand new. Installed it this past weekend along with some longtubes and the sound is unbelievable. Like nothing I've ever heard on a mustang. I originally had an off-road h on the car but swithed to this and love it. It doesnt seem to beas raspy like the other x-pipes but is smooth and gives a high pitched scream up top. The only tricky thing was installing the 7 different pipes with clamps and i now need to get it all welded together.
